The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ies with a requirement for Design Patterns sk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Design Patterns over the 6 months to 5 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
5 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 168 155 96
Rank change year-on-year -13 -59 +52
Permanent jobs citing Design Patterns 1,705 2,423 5,592
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 1.73% 2.34% 3.57%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 2.01% 2.45% 3.73%
Number of salaries quoted 1,080 1,417 2,197
10th Percentile £37,500 £46,750 £41,250
25th Percentile £50,500 £55,000 £50,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£62,500 £72,500 £67,000
Median % change year-on-year -13.79% +8.21% +10.38%
75th Percentile £80,000 £92,500 £87,500
90th Percentile £95,000 £112,500 £100,000
UK excluding London median annual salary £60,000 £62,500 £57,500
% change year-on-year -4.00% +8.70% +9.52%
